Abstract

The sediment of dead leaves, the earth and sand cause the decrease in pondages and the water pollution in the lake or sea. To remove such sediments, an air lift pump attracts attention because it is hard to occlude by its simple structure. The bubble-jet-type air lift pump developed by Sadatomi can remove sediments which traditional air lift pump couldn't remove. The bubble jet generator which was also developed by Sadatomi is used in the bubble-jet-type air lift pump as an air supply. Using the bubble jet generator, it can forcibly levitate sludge accumulating on the bottom of lake or sea. Our purpose is to improve water quality and to increase the pondage with the bubble-jet-type air lift pump. In this paper, experimental results on the performance of the bubble-jet-type air lift pump are mainly reported.
